#07192e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#07192e is composed of 2.7% red, 9.8%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.8% cyan, 45.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 82% black. It has a hue angle of 212.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 10.4%. #07192e color hex could be obtained by blending #0e325c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

#07192e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#07192e has RGB values of R:7, G:25,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 465198.

Shades and Tints of #07192e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02060c is the darkest color, while #fafcfe is the lightest one.
